编程和编码匹配的区别是什么

fiy 其他 24

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程和编码是计算机领域中常用的两个术语。虽然它们在某些情况下可以互换使用,但它们在含义和使用方式上有一些区别。

    编程是指使用特定的编程语言,按照一定的逻辑和算法,编写代码来实现特定的功能或解决问题的过程。编程是一种创造性的过程,需要思考和设计程序的整体结构和功能。编程的目标是实现某种功能或解决某个问题,因此编程更加注重算法和逻辑的设计。编程的重点在于思考问题的解决方案,并将其转化为计算机可以理解和执行的代码。

    编码是指将某种信息或数据转化为特定的编码形式,以便于计算机处理和传输。编码是一种将信息转化为可识别的编码系统的过程。在编码过程中,常用的编码方式包括二进制、十进制、十六进制等。编码的目标是将信息转化为计算机可以处理的形式,并确保信息的准确性和完整性。编码更注重将信息转化为计算机可以理解的形式,而不关注解决问题的逻辑和算法。

    综上所述,编程和编码虽然有一定的重叠,但它们在含义和使用方式上有一些区别。编程更关注于问题的解决方案的设计和实现,而编码更注重将信息转化为计算机可以理解的形式。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程和编码是计算机领域中常用的术语,它们有着不同的含义和用法。下面是它们的区别:

    1. 含义:

      • 编程:编程是指使用计算机编程语言来创建算法和指令,以实现特定任务的过程。它涉及到设计、开发、调试和测试代码,以及解决问题和实现功能。
      • 编码:编码是指将信息转换为可被计算机理解和处理的形式的过程。它涉及到使用特定的编码规则和标准将数据转换为二进制形式,以便于计算机存储和处理。
    2. 目的:

      • 编程:编程的目的是创建一个可执行的程序,用于实现特定的功能或解决特定的问题。它涉及到算法设计和逻辑思维,以及将问题分解为可执行的指令序列。
      • 编码:编码的目的是将信息转换为计算机可以理解的形式,以便于存储和处理。它涉及到将符号和字符转换为二进制代码,以便于计算机进行处理和传输。
    3. 过程:

      • 编程:编程过程包括分析问题、设计算法、选择编程语言、编写代码、调试和测试代码等步骤。它需要程序员具备逻辑思维、算法设计和编程技巧。
      • 编码:编码过程包括选择编码规则、将符号和字符转换为二进制代码、进行错误检测和纠正等步骤。它需要遵循特定的编码标准和规范。
    4. 范围:

      • 编程:编程是一个广泛的概念,涵盖了从高级语言编程到底层机器语言编程的各种层次和领域。它可以用于开发各种类型的应用程序、网站、游戏等。
      • 编码:编码通常是指将文本、图像、音频等信息转换为二进制形式的过程。它可以用于数据传输、数据存储、图像处理、音频压缩等领域。
    5. 技能要求:

      • 编程:编程需要掌握一种或多种编程语言,具备算法设计和逻辑思维能力,以及解决问题和实现功能的能力。
      • 编码:编码需要了解不同的编码规则和标准,以及如何将字符和符号转换为二进制代码的方法。

    总的来说,编程和编码虽然有些相似,但它们的含义和用法是不同的。编程是指使用编程语言创建程序的过程,而编码是将信息转换为计算机可理解的形式的过程。编程更关注解决问题和实现功能,而编码更关注数据的转换和处理。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程和编码是计算机领域中常用的两个术语,它们在含义和用法上有一些区别。

    1. 概念定义:

      • 编程(Programming):指的是使用一种编程语言来创建计算机程序的过程。编程涉及到问题分析、算法设计、编写代码等一系列步骤。
      • 编码(Coding):指的是将算法和逻辑转化为特定编程语言的语法和规则的过程。编码是编程的一部分,是将问题的解决方案转化为可执行的代码的过程。
    2. 目标和过程:

      • 编程的目标是解决问题或实现特定的功能。编程者需要分析问题的要求,设计算法和数据结构,并将其转化为可执行的程序。
      • 编码是实现编程目标的过程,它将问题的解决方案转化为特定编程语言的代码。编码者需要了解编程语言的语法和规则,并按照要求编写正确的代码。
    3. 技能要求:

      • 编程需要具备问题分析、逻辑思维、算法设计等能力,以及对编程语言和开发工具的熟悉和掌握。
      • 编码需要对特定编程语言的语法和规则进行了解和掌握,以及对编程技术和开发工具的熟练运用。
    4. 注意事项:

      • 编程是一个复杂的过程,需要考虑问题的各个方面,包括输入输出、边界条件、错误处理等。编程者需要有耐心和细心。
      • 编码需要遵循编程语言的语法和规则,遵循代码风格和命名规范。编码者需要注重代码的可读性和可维护性。

    总的来说,编程是解决问题的过程,而编码是将问题的解决方案转化为特定编程语言的代码的过程。编程是一个更加综合和抽象的概念,而编码更加具体和实际。在实际的开发过程中,编程和编码往往是紧密相连的,需要相互配合完成任务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部